| hello, I'm new here, and this is my first post to the group so I wanted to jump in appropriately - Mastercook 7.0 - 8.0 both are for sale on ebay quite reasonably priced. ebay link to mastercook it's the best software that I've used for writing custom cookbooks. I'm presently starting a new book on niche cooking and wanted to tool up with software which includes auto nutritional analysis - re-portioning and also grocery listing for each recipe you input, automatically. yep you just say do it and voila. for me I like to K.I.S.S. so that's the ticket. this should make writing and converting my book a snap. as well it's the best format from what I hear for submission for reviews or possible printing.
